Swansboro is located in the United States, specifically in North Carolina, with GPS coordinates 34.68766, -77.11912. Situated along the Crystal Coast of North Carolina, it is known for its picturesque waterfront, charming downtown area, and proximity to natural attractions such as the Croatan National Forest and the Intracoastal Waterway. The city operates within the America/New_York timezone, aligning with Eastern Standard Time.
Swansboro is recognized for its vibrant fishing and boating community, as well as annual events like the Swansboro Mullet Festival, which celebrates the local culture and economy. The city’s regional significance stems from its appeal to tourists seeking outdoor recreational activities and its role as a gateway to nearby coastal destinations.
Timezone in Swansboro
Swansboro operates on Eastern Time, specifically in the America/New_York timezone, which has a UTC offset of -5 hours during standard time. When daylight saving time is in effect, the offset changes to -4 hours. Daylight saving time begins on the second Sunday in March, when clocks are set forward one hour, and it ends on the first Sunday in November, when clocks are set back one hour.
This means that for about half the year, Swansboro is one hour ahead of its standard time. In comparison to other parts of the United States, particularly those in different time zones like Pacific Time or Mountain Time, Swansboro is three hours ahead of Pacific Time and two hours ahead of Mountain Time. Attractions and Activities in Swansboro
Swansboro, located in North Carolina, is known for its charming coastal atmosphere and historic significance. It is often referred to as the “Gateway to the Crystal Coast,” serving as a popular starting point for visitors exploring the beautiful beaches and waterways of the region. The town is situated along the White Oak River, providing ample opportunities for water-based activities such as fishing, kayaking, and boating.
The downtown area features quaint shops, local eateries, and historic buildings, which reflect the town’s rich maritime heritage. Swansboro hosts various events throughout the year, including the annual Mullet Festival, celebrating local culture with food, music, and crafts. The nearby Hammocks Beach State Park offers visitors access to unspoiled beaches and natural landscapes, making it a perfect spot for outdoor enthusiasts.

Practical Information for Visitors
Swansboro is accessible primarily by car, as it does not have a major airport or train station. The nearest airport is Coastal Carolina Regional Airport in New Bern, about 30 miles away, which offers domestic flights. For public transport, Greyhound buses stop nearby, but renting a car is recommended for convenience in exploring the area.
The weather in Swansboro is generally mild, with hot summers and mild winters. Summer temperatures can reach the low 90s Fahrenheit, while winter lows rarely drop below freezing. The best time to visit is in the spring and fall when temperatures are more moderate, and the humidity is lower, making outdoor activities more enjoyable.
